Trades Generalist (Electrician/Carpenter) - (Job Number: 2204186)

Job Description

- Conduct inspections on mechanical and electrical locksets on campus, as well as CCTV, electrified access control, and intrusion detection system hardware, and determine maintenance needs.
- Plans new installation, alterations and testing of CCTV, electrified access control, and intrusion detection systems. Estimate materials and labor required to complete project.
- Use and maintain electrical and carpentry tools, machines, equipment and materials used for job related tasks.
- Understand and carry out written and verbal instructions. Resolve most job-related problems that may arise.
- Fabricate various control panels, locking hardware and associate wiring. Make necessary adjustments and inspect complete work.
- Provide other duties as assigned to include reports to management as necessary.
!*!Required Qualifications: Per Civil Service Standards and Specifications. Four years of full-time experience under a skilled journey-level Electrician, which would provide training equivalent to that given apprenticeship program. Apprenticeship training gained by completion of technical courses in a trade at a school or institute, may be substituted for the above experience on a year-for-year basis. The Trades Generalist performs journey level work in Electrical and semi skilled level work in Carpentry. Must have, keep and maintain the appropriate valid NYS Driver’s License; have a motor vehicle record which is free from major violations or a pattern of repeat violations. (***Out-of-State Applicants, see "Special Notes”). Must have the ability to perform the physical tasks of the position, such as bending, lifting, stretching and climbing. Must have the ability to work from a ladder, scaffolding or man lift over 10 feet in height.
Preferred Qualifications: Electrician experience to include two years experience in the installation and/or repair of card access doors, alarm systems, CCTV systems, and parking meter repairs and semi-skilled work in the carpentry trade. Knowledge of low voltage electric applications for parking meters, access control, alarm systems and closed circuit television (CCTV) systems. One year experience doing access control work. Experience in parking gate repairs. Ability to diagnose problems with parking meters, gate arms, access control hardware, alarm systems and CCTV systems. Lock shop experience preferred.
Brief Description of Duties: The primary function for this position is to perform all electronic physical security related duties including conducting inspections, determining maintenance needs, installing, repairing, etc. for Access Control. This position includes both electrical and the secondary trade is carpentry.
